Senior Underwriter - Healthcare Professional Liability

Skyward Specialty Insurance is seeking a Senior Underwriter specializing in Medical Malpractice and Healthcare Professional Liability. This role involves managing a profitable book of business, negotiating policy terms, and developing underwriting strategies while collaborating with various business functions.

Responsibilities

Produce, underwrite, manage and service a profitable book of new and renewal business
Utilize underwriter authority in accordance with the published underwriting guidelines
Effectively negotiate and secure policy terms that align with the company directives and provide detailed explanations regarding terms, conditions and requirements of quotes and rating decisions
Analyze claims activity and loss experience
Compose, prepare, and generate correspondence, proposals, and underwriting reports as needed or required
Develop and communicate new business or renewal rate recommendations and decisions in accordance with level of underwriting authority
Ability to seek out and secure new and profitable business
Develop and manage underwriting strategies and monitor performance of assigned portfolio of accounts, and initiate actions to improve performance when needed
Manage and develop effective producer and client relationships throughout assigned territory
Coordinate strategy and work collaboratively with other aligned business functions including claims, actuarial, loss control and others
Make internal and external presentations as necessary to communicate portfolio performance to peers, producers, and leadership as necessary
Provide direction and support to associate underwriters as a coach/mentor or trainer and/or provide peer review

Skyward Specialty is a rapidly growing and innovative specialty insurance company, delivering commercial P&C products and solutions on a non-admitted and admitted basis.
